The Story

The Kizeto Brown yunomi features a captivating deep orange-brown hue that blends seamlessly with soft sand yellow tones, reminiscent of the tranquil beauty found in a desert sunrise. Minoware, recognized as Mino-yaki (美濃焼), is a distinguished form of Japanese pottery that hails from the historic Mino Province, including the charming towns of Tajimi, Toki, Mizunami, and Kawagoei in Gifu Prefecture. This exquisite pottery is crafted from the fertile soil of Gifu and holds the title of Japan's oldest pottery, with a history dating back to the 7th century. In the rich tapestry of Japan's tea ceremony culture, the emphasis on appreciating beauty in its purest form is essential. This philosophy inspires the design of teacups and ceramics, which are initially shaped from natural, coarse clay. The fusion of traditional and contemporary styles reflects the ongoing evolution and timeless heritage of these renowned kilns. Dimension: 3.7"(W) x 3.5"(H) Capacity: 8.5oz / 251ml Origin: Japan Handwash
